The Larkspur component library follows strict semver, and every consuming app pins an exact version in its lockfile. If a rendering regression appears after a release, first confirm which minor version the affected app resolved, then check the changelog for breaking prop renames — these have slipped into patch releases twice before. Roll back by pinning the previous version and triggering a redeploy; do not hotfix the library under incident conditions. Record the affected app's build token, shown below.

pipeline stamp: htk3_a71

Ticket: BOT-2193 — Config drift in stale-branch cleanup bot

The Twigreaper bot on the build host is running settings that don't match source control: retention window and protected-branch list were changed manually last week. It deleted two branches it shouldn't have. Pause the bot until reconciled. The values currently active on the host are below.

service settings:
PRAIX_LOG_LEVEL=error
PRAIX_METRICS_HOST=metrics.praix.qorvelcorp.corp
PRAIX_POOL_SIZE=16

## Configuration

The Bramleigh gateway sits behind the Torwick load balancer, which probes `/healthz` every five seconds. The probe must return within 800ms or the node is drained, so keep the handler free of database calls. Set `HEALTH_PORT` to match the balancer's target group, and enable `DEEP_CHECK=false` in production unless Ops requests otherwise. Deep checks authenticate against the status aggregator, which requires a shared credential in the same env file. Place the aggregator secret on the line immediately following this one.

vault entry, kagep-yajeg: COURIER_KEY5=da097